This is @Right_to_Life's most deceptive statement of all. The cells are not "tissue." Tissue is made of more than cells. These cells have been replicating in culture for 55+ years. It's unlikely that a single protein or DNA molecule from the original tissue remains.https://twitter.com/Right_to_Life/status/1006529874557915136 …
